MEDICAL ACTION INDUSTRIES REPORTS
THIRD QUARTER FISCAL 2011 RESULTS
Company Focused on AVID Acquisition Integration
BRENTWOOD, NY, February 1, 2011 – Medical Action Industries Inc. (NASDAQ/MDCI), a supplier of medical and surgical disposable products, today reported results for the fiscal 2011 third quarter ended December 31, 2010.
Net sales for the fiscal 2011 third quarter were $104,477,000 an increase of $31,301,000 or 43%, above the $73,176,000 in net sales reported for the comparable three months of fiscal 2010. Net sales for the most recent quarter included $33,104,000 in custom procedure tray sales generated by AVID Medical, Inc. which was acquired by Medical Action on August 27, 2010. Excluding sales of custom procedure trays, Medical Action’s net sales for the three months ended December 31, 2010 were $71,373,000 representing a decline of $1,803,000 or 2%, from the comparable prior year period.
Net income for the fiscal 2011 third quarter was $2,304,000 or $0.14 per basic and diluted share, versus $4,010,000 or $0.25 per basic and diluted share reported for the comparable three months of fiscal 2010.

Net sales for the nine months ended December 31, 2010 were $257,221,000 an increase of $38,298,000 or 17%, from the $218,923,000 in net sales reported for the comparable nine months of fiscal 2010. Net income for the nine months ended December 31, 2010 was $3,269,000 or $0.20 per basic and diluted share, compared to the $11,647,000 or $0.72 per basic and diluted share, reported for the comparable nine months of fiscal 2010. Included in net income for the nine months ended December 31, 2010 were an extraordinary loss of $1,455,000 or $0.05 per basic and diluted share (net of applicable tax benefit), due to weather-related water damage at an off-site warehouse used to store finished goods inventory and one time transaction costs of $1,335,000 or $0.05 per basic and diluted share (net of applicable tax benefit) related to the acquisition of AVID Medical, Inc.
“Our management team remains focused on completing the integration of AVID Medical, Inc.,” said Chief Executive Officer and President, Paul D. Meringolo. “While there remains work to be done to fully execute our integration strategies, we are very pleased with our progress. We have completed the consolidation of our sales teams and will finish integration of manufacturing operations during our fiscal fourth quarter. We are now engaged in activities focused on growing sales of custom procedure trays, as well as our existing product lines through our fully staffed sales and marketing teams.”
“While market conditions and customer ordering patterns continue to be unsettled, we remain optimistic that we will provide positive results over the next few quarters”, Meringolo said. “The ongoing, broad based market rally in commodities is placing pressure on the cost of our raw materials, principally cotton and resin, and is adversely effecting our gross margins. We are responding to these rising commodity prices by increasing selling prices where market conditions and our supply contracts permit, managing raw material costs and controlling our operating expenses.”

Medical Action is a diversified manufacturer and distributor of disposable medical devices and a leader in many of the markets where it competes. Its products are marketed primarily to acute care facilities in domestic and certain international markets. The Company has expanded its target market to include physician, dental and veterinary offices, out-patient surgery centers, long-term care facilities and laboratories. Medical Action’s products are marketed nationally by its direct sales personnel and extensive network of healthcare distributors. The Company has preferred vendor agreements with national and regional distributors, as well as sole and multi-source agreements with group purchasing organizations. Medical Action’s common stock trades on the NASDAQ Global Select Market under the symbol MDCI and is included in the Russell 2000 Index.
